In the future, four supervillains rule the U.S. and have carved it up into nation states.

The four conquerors are Doctor Doom, Red Skull, Magneto and … Abomination?!?

Hm. How did that happen?

Anyway, Red Skull runs the North American continent and he’s killed nearly all of its superheroes, but Logan is in hiding in the California desert, along with his family. These are his landlords:

The Hulk Gang, a bunch of redneck descendants of Bruce Banner.

After getting a beat down from Hulk Gang because he was unable to pay rent, Logan gets a visit from Clint Barton. He hires him to go to the New Babylon to help him deliver a “secret package.”

Wolverine needs the money to protect his family, so he agrees.

They meet lots of other descendants/future version heroes–most of whom will not be seen on Earth 616, so I’m not tagging them. But they are lots of fun. Especially Barton’s daughter, Spider-Bitch…

She’s a badass.

Also in their trip across the country, they meet Moloids and a Venom dinosaur.

Through flashbacks, we learn that Wolverine is now a pacifist–having stopped using his claws after he was tricked by Mysterio into slaughtering his fellow X-Men.

He tried to kill himself after that by lying in front of a train, but he couldn’t die–so he simply killed off his Wolverine identity.

Clint dies along the way (but he’ll get a prequel series later, so I tagged him), but eventually, Logan gets to D.C. and finds out that the secret package was the last portions of the super soldier serum–hoping to create an army of heroes to overthrow Red Skull.

Wolverine kills Red Skull in the end–cutting off his head using Captain America’s shield.

He thus gets through nearly all of this adventure without ever popping his claws.

Until he gets home and finds out Hulk Gang murdered his family.

So he slaughters all of them.

And rides off into the sunset.
